About this print
A rusted farm plough sits on open grazing land near the former Elrington Colliery site, outside Abernethy in the Hunter Valley. The colliery closed in December 1962 after BHP cited persistent operating losses, leaving large reserves of coal still in the ground. The surface around the mine has since returned to agriculture. The plough in the frame is a reminder of how completely the land reverted once the colliery was gone, shafts sealed, branch railway dismantled in 1963, and the ground given back to grass and livestock.
